It's a truly big choice. Your selection of clinical institution will impact your life for years to come, so it is essential to select the very best university for you. There more than 40 clinical schools in the UK however you can just pick 4 on your UCAS application. All medical schools teach a little in a different way, however all need to stick to criteria established by the General Medical Council (GMC), so that you meet minimal needs when you graduate. Phlebotomy Classes.


The initial and most essential point to think about is the access requirements of each medical institution. This might sound counterproductive but there is no factor in picking a medical school with the requirements of which you can not fulfill.


Some area weight on the results of admissions tests like the UCAT, some take even more account of the individual declaration, and others consider the general impact they have of you as a person. It is very unlikely that a clinical institution will certainly make an exemption for an application that stops working to fulfill among their minimum entry criteria, despite how good the application is in various other ways.

Medical school mentor styles are usually identified into traditional, problem-based, or integrated teaching. Standard clinical programs consist of Oxford and Cambridge, while problem-based programs include Manchester, Sheffield, Liverpool and Glasgow.


That being stated, this technique is often utilized as component of the GMC's advised integrated design. Make certain you know why you picked the course before your interview! Depending on whether you are using for straight or, you'll have various alternatives although some universities use both.
